When working with probabilities why is it sometimes necessary to add and sometimes to multiply?

Whether you need to add or multiply depends on whether it is a case of 'AND' or 'OR'. For 'AND' you multiply, and for 'OR' you add. Below are examples of each case, using dice as an example: To calculate the...
